The first step in designing the cooling system of a turbo generator is the ventilation system analysis. The present paper deals with a comprehensive investigation of flowparameters of a high power turbo generator. By employing the lumped-parameter model in the closed circuit of the flownetwork, the cooling medium flowrate and pressure drop in each element is calculated. In addition, considering the fan characteristic curve, the operation point of the fan is specifiedand consequently the fan can be further optimized. Furthermore, the results are verified by the equality of the total pressure drop experienced by flow and the total pressure rise generated by fan and rotor speed. The results are in good agreement with the available official data
